    Abstract

    The general mathematics model for aerosol mass measurement by using the counting method is analyzed, and the result indicates that the total mass of aerosol can be expressed as linear addition of counting channels. The light scattering counting method for spherical particles mass measurement was studied as an example. Starting with aerosol mass subset Ni, the fractal relation φ=Lβ between scattering luminous flux of counting channels and aerosol’s average volume can be gained according to statistics. Based on this, the general function (φj )≡ρj=ρL-ηφηj of average mass j and characteristic parameter φ of counting channels can be established, where η is the equivalent section fractal dimension with the range from 0 to 3. In further, all of these were extended to non-spherical particles mass measurement, and then the full mathematics model for aerosol mass measurement founded on light scattering counting method was established. This model provides a feasible way for the counter to measure aerosol mass concentration in real time.
